3D Printing in Dental Surgery



To enhance the field of dental surgery, you can check out the subtopic of 3D printing in dental surgery. This ingenious modern technology has the potential to revolutionize the means oral cosmetic surgeons run and deal with people. Right here are four key methods which 3D printing is shaping the area:

- ** Custom-made Surgical Guides **: 3D printing enables the creation of extremely precise and patient-specific medical overviews, boosting the accuracy and efficiency of treatments.

- ** Implant Prosthetics **: With 3D printing, dental doctors can create tailored implant prosthetics that perfectly fit a client's unique anatomy, causing far better results and individual complete satisfaction.

-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, minimizing the demand for traditional implanting methods and boosting healing and recuperation time.

- ** Education and Training **: 3D printing can be used to develop realistic surgical versions for educational functions, permitting oral doctors to practice intricate treatments before executing them on clients.

With its possible to boost precision, customization, and training, 3D printing is an amazing growth in the field of dental surgery.
